We stayed at Maison Rohmer for a week at the beginning of September 2017. The house was delightful and the pool area very beautiful. We had a brilliant week with fantastic weather. We loved the village of Gordes so magical and magnificent. Market day on Tuesdays is a must. There is so much to see and do though I must admit we did a lot of lazy days by the pool. Things I would recommend a visit to Domaine De La Citadelle vineyard, beautiful wines and a very informative talk on how they produce. We also had a fabulous canoe trip with canoe evasion at Fontaine-de- Vaucluse. It's a must. We really enjoyed our stay and hope to be back one day.

We all had a great time and fully enjoyed the house and the property. The overall layout of the house and inside the rooms is very thoughtful and was perfect for all of us. We had three families, 4 kids of different ages and a grandma. The different spaces allowed us to handle the different kid routines and moods in a way that gave everyone privacy. The kitchen is large and extremely well furnished. Makes it comfortable to cook for large groups. The pool is actually enormous. The way Patrick takes care of it seems to produce much better results than I have seen in other places: the water stayed clear all the way through. The pool house is an incredibly valuable area, especially because it is so well furnished, this is a serious luxury. The small supermarket in St-Antonin-du-Var is surprisingly good, if you are not a big cook you could totally live off this (they opened on Sunday am!). We also organised a Casino home delivery for the day before we arrived. We used P and Geraldine for 16 hours a week, to get the kitchen cleaned, make the beds, light housekeeping, remove rubbish, clean the BBQ and pool house areas and this made a huge positive difference.

An amazing week spent with family celebrating a 50th birthday location was perfect, quiet but close to amenities such as a lovely bakery and shops. The property has everything: plenty of space to relax but also plenty of space to socialise and mingle. Philippe was an amazing host, providing an introduction to the property and location, bringing pastries twice during our stay. Great wine tour of Saint-Chinian and evening meal at Le Pourquoi Pas (which was to die for food and location). Highly recommend during your stay to take a boat tour down the Canal du Midi from Colombiers and kayaking down the river Orb from Roquebun. Thank you for your hospitality.
